Why Easter? is a concise, easy-to-read study of the very real questions people may have about Jesus and why his birth, death and resurrection are central to the Christian faith.

Over 8.5 million copies of this popular booklet have been sold across the world since it was first published. Written by Nicky Gumbel, it explores why we need Jesus and how he satisfies our hunger for meaning and purpose in life, for life beyond death, and for forgiveness.

Exploring Jesus' claims, character and death, Nicky uses effortlessly uncomplicated language to talk about the freedom we receive from guilt, addition, and fear, and the freedom to know God, to love other people, and to change.

Why Easter? is illustrated throughout by Charlie Mackesy, author of the best-selling book ‘The Boy, the Mole, the Fox and the Horse’.
